01 · RequirementThe stage in full →

The sentence somebody wrote, kept as they wrote it

A requirement arrives as prose, hedged and ambiguous. AI grills it into typed claims and blocking questions. A person answers them once, and the answers become part of the artifact.

AI drafts
Claims, blocking questions, data scenarios and the type of every term used.
You rule on
Every answer to every blocking question, and which claims were inventions.
It leaves behind
A requirement that can be argued with, dated and attributed, still readable in two years.

Argue with a draft, not with a blank page

Discovery reads your estate and proposes concepts, grain and join paths, each binding carrying a confidence and a stated reason. Modelling becomes a review, and the review is where the expertise goes.

AI drafts
Candidate concepts, the grain each measure could be at, join paths, and the physical bindings that would satisfy them.
You rule on
Grain, exclusions, the join decision, and every binding that gets accepted.
It leaves behind
A typed, diffable model where every inference states what it was inferred from.

Generated, not typed

Tables, layer pipelines, jobs and metric definitions all generate from the one model a person approved: Databricks-native, in source format, deterministic from what was agreed.

AI drafts
Bronze, silver and gold DDL, the layer runners, the job definitions and the metric views.
You rule on
What was approved in the model. Nothing downstream is authored by hand, so nothing downstream can disagree with it.
It leaves behind
Generated artifacts you can read, diff and run on your own platform, with the model they came from named in each one.

The gate the lifecycle passes through

Controls bind to the same model, at the moment the meaning is decided rather than months later. The verdict issues the release token, and what it leaves behind is reproducible eighteen months on.

AI drafts
The checks each claim implies, mapped to a vendor-neutral catalogue and parameterised to your assets.
You rule on
Thresholds, waivers, and which failures are allowed to hold a release.
It leaves behind
A verdict retained with its control version, parameters, query and observed value.
05 · VisualizeThe stage in full →

The number arrives with its reasons attached

Lakeview and Power BI outputs generated from the same model, so a figure on a page can still name the claim it answers, the control that held it and the requirement that asked for it.

AI drafts
The dashboard, its metric definitions, and the lineage that links every figure back up the chain.
You rule on
What deserves to be on the page at all, and which figures need their provenance shown rather than stored.
It leaves behind
A published product whose every number can be walked back to the sentence that asked for it.
Two ways in

Start from a requirement someone wrote, or a table you already have.

Design-first works with nothing connected. You can specify, argue about and generate a customer’s data product before anyone hands you credentials, which is when the design still matters most. Discover-first reads the estate you have and drafts the model from it. Both meet at the same stage two.
